Using Glebostan restores the microbiological balance, resulting in improved condition of cultivated plants.


Properly conducted mineralization of post-harvest residues, through the introduction of bacteria with targeted action into the soil, positively affects the cycle of elements such as phosphorus (P), potassium (K), sulfur (S), and optimizes nitrogen management. Through increased microbiological activity, soil aggregation improves, leading to better availability of nutrients, resulting in higher yields and better commercial quality of the crop. The desired granular structure of the soil’s cultivated layer creates favorable conditions for seed germination and proper—optimal—development of the plant root system in the cultivated layer. The granules form a spatial, spongy complex which, thanks to its porous structure, absorbs and retains water and nutrients. Properly conducted mineralization of post-harvest residues by introducing bacteria with targeted action into the soil:

                •             accelerates the decomposition of crop residues,

                •             increases the content of humus and nutrients in the soil,

                •             optimizes nitrogen management by increasing the level of readily available nitrogen for plants,

                •             enhances water and mineral retention in soil structures,

                •             raises the availability of easily assimilable forms of phosphorus,

                •             improves soil aggregation,

                •             supports optimal development of the plant root system,

                •             increases yield and its commercial quality,

                •             limits the development of fungal diseases and stress related to water deficiency,

                •             protects the soil environment and accelerates herbicide degradation.


Composition

The composition of the preparation is a specially selected chain of soil bacteria from the Bacillus group and an organic carrier that serves as a breeding ground for bacteria.


Dosage

Apply in the form of a spray using a suspension in the amount of

100 g per 1 ha (100 g of concentrate should be mixed with 300 to 500 liters of water).

The prepared suspension should be sprayed on the field in the pre-sowing period or post-harvest.

2. Humic Acids that contributes to:

  • They improve the physical structure of the soil, leading to the formation of a proper granular structure, which increases aeration and water retention capacity, reducing the risk of drought and improving soil air-water conditions.

  • They increase the soil’s water holding capacity, facilitating water and nutrient uptake by plants and protecting them from water deficits.

  • They stimulate the growth and multiplication of beneficial soil microflora, including nitrogen-fixing bacteria and microorganisms that decompose organic matter, which enhances soil biological activity and accelerates the mineralization of plant residues.

  • They improve the availability of mineral and organic nutrients (e.g., nitrogen, phosphorus, potassium) by chelating metal ions, retaining fertilizers in the root zone, neutralizing soil pH, and reducing nutrient leaching.

  • They protect plants by limiting the impact of mineral salts, pesticides, and toxic substances in the soil, which decreases plant stress and improves crop quality.

  • They strengthen root system development, enabling plants to better absorb water and nutrients, promoting plant health and yield.
